Huawei Digital Power Unveils Innovations to Accelerate Global Energy Transformation at Intersolar Europe 2025
Huawei Digital Power's Role in the Global Energy Transition
In recent years, the discourse surrounding renewable energy has shifted significantly, with major players vying for innovation in the sector. At the forefront is Huawei Digital Power, which showcased its latest advancements during the Intersolar Europe 2025 event held in Munich, Germany. Entitled "Smart PV and ESS Powering a Grid of the Future," the event drew approximately 300 customers and partners from across the globe, emphasizing the adoption of Energy Storage Systems (ESS) as integral to next-gen energy infrastructures.
Huawei's unveiling of its FusionSolar Strategy was a cornerstone of the conference, with company representatives laying out a roadmap for how ESS technology can support the rapid transformation towards sustainable energy solutions. The strategic goal, outlined by Steven Zhou, president of the Smart PV and ESS product line, focuses on integrating the so-called '4T' technologies: bit, watt, heat, and battery – unified to create robust new energy frameworks.

Innovations on the Ground
Huawei's technologies have already begun making an impact, demonstrated in significant projects like the 1.3 GWh ESS and 400 MW PV installation near the Red Sea in the Middle East, marking the world's largest PV+ESS microgrid operating entirely on renewable energy. This innovative microgrid has been delivering more than 1 billion kWh of green electricity over 18 months, showcasing the viability of Huawei's systems in real-world applications. The achievement underscores the effectiveness of Huawei's intelligent designs, which have enhanced flexibility in high-altitude conditions, such as those seen at their installation in Ngari, China.
Moreover, their recent flagship residential ESS LUNA S1-7kWh emphasizes energy independence for households, boasting the industry’s leading 15-year warranty and 40% more usable energy than its competitors.
